Gregarius - A Free, Web-based Feed Aggregator - web-based, so you can read your feeds anywhere. Install it on your own server. Reads RSS/RDF/Atom. Features AJAX powered item tagging, full-text search, opml import. Gregarius is free, open-source and has some useful plugins for added functionality and themes to change the look.

I'm going to give it a try. I'm a longtime Bloglines user but have been looking for a full-featured solution I can host myself.
